1. Why is the assessed value significantly lower than recent sale prices?
Municipal assessed values for tax purposes often lag behind current market values, especially in appreciating neighbourhoods. The assessed value here may not reflect recent market conditions or specific upgrades.

4. The basement is "not renovated." What are the implications?
This means the basement is unfinished but ready for development. It presents additional cost for finishing but also offers the opportunity to customize the space to a new owner's specifications without needing to undo previous work.
